Power outage affects parts of South River during emergency wire repairs

SOUTH RIVER, N.J.Portions of South River experienced a temporary power outage Wednesday evening as emergency crews worked to repair electrical wires, according to the South River Police Department.

The outage occurred between approximately 7:45 p.m. and 8:45 p.m., impacting areas that were also affected by a similar incident the previous night. Officials did not specify which neighborhoods were involved but confirmed the affected zones were consistent with Tuesday s outage.

Between approximately 7:45 PM and 8:45 PM tonight, portions of South River will experience a power outage while emergency repairs to wires are completed, the department said in a statement shared on Facebook.

The nature of the wire damage has not been disclosed, and it remains unclear whether the issue is part of a larger infrastructure concern. No injuries or emergencies related to the outage were reported as of late Wednesday.

The South River Police Department said updates will be provided as they become available.
